Some program manager at IARPA must be a YUUUUGE fan of Tolkien’s Lord of the Rings since there’s a program called Amon-Hen , which in the LOTR lore is where Frodo ran to after Boromir got a little too handsy. In the movie, its where Fellowship broke apart after getting ambushed by Orcs.
Hilariously enough, in Sindarin, it apparently means Hill of the Eye , which makes sense considering the program objective is about using ground based interferometers as a GEO imaging system.
